Half a century after the Beatles set foot on US soil for the first time, America is celebrating the first British band to make it big stateside
They came, they sang, they conquered. And 50 years after four young men from
Liverpool with rebellious "mopcut" haircuts and a cheeky swagger
set foot on US soil for the first time, America will for the next two weeks
embark on a golden anniversary spree of Beatlemania.
